Principles of Optical Fibers

Optical fibers are long, thin strands of glass or plastic that transmit light signals over long distances. They operate on the principles of total internal reflection, where light rays are guided through the core of the fiber by successive reflections off the inner surface of the cladding. The core and cladding have different refractive indices, ensuring that the light rays are confined within the core.

Transmission Characteristics

The transmission characteristics of optical fibers are determined by several factors:

  • Attenuation: The loss of light power over distance due to absorption, scattering, and bending.
  • Dispersion: The broadening of light pulses over distance caused by different wavelengths traveling at different speeds.
  • Nonlinear Effects: Changes in the refractive index of the fiber under high optical power, leading to signal distortions and limitations on transmission capacity.
  • Modal Behavior: The number of light modes (paths) that can propagate through the fiber. Single-mode fibers support only one mode, while multimode fibers support multiple modes.
